The space behind an opaque object where light doesn't reach is called a "shadow." A shadow forms because the opaque object blocks the path of light, preventing it from illuminating the area behind it. The characteristics of a shadow, such as its size and shape, depend on the light source's position and intensity.

An object that does not let light pass through it is called opaque. It absorbs or reflects light, preventing it from transmitting through the object. Examples of opaque objects include wood, metal, and walls.

When light encounters an opaque object, the object absorbs or scatters the light, preventing it from passing through. This results in the shadow effect as no light can pass through the object, creating a dark area behind it.
Light forms a shadow on an opaque object because it travels in straight lines. When light is blocked by an opaque object, it cannot reach the surface behind the object, creating a shadow. This property is known as the rectilinear propagation of light.
